泸州麻将开发公司-学习林西apk软件制作的完整教程:从入门到精通



微信搜索"m258654en"添加客服微信获取报价
学习林西APK软件制作过程中,需要掌握的技能包括:熟练使用Java语言、掌握Android开发基础知识、熟悉APK文件的结构、具备软件开发的思维与逻辑能力。本文将从入门到精通地介绍学习林西APK软件制作的完整教程。
1. 入门篇:学习Java语言
要想制作APK软件,首先需要掌握Java语言的基础。Java是一种面向对象的编程语言,具备良好的可移植性和跨平台性。需要掌握Java语言基本语法、面向对象编程思想、Java开发工具的使用等知识。
2. Android开发篇:掌握Android基础知识
Android开发是基于Java语言进行的,以适应各类智能移动设备的开发平台。需要掌握Android开发基础知识,例如:Android应用程序框架、UI控件的使用、Activity、Intent等概念。同时还需要掌握Android开发常用工具的使用,如:Android Studio、Gradle、adb等。
3. APK文件结构篇:熟悉APK文件的结构
APK文件是Android应用程序的打包文件,也是Android应用程序安装包。APK文件结构包含多个文件夹和文件,如META-INF、lib、res、assets、AndroidManifest.xml等。需要熟悉APK文件的结构,以便于进行APK软件的制作和修改。
4. 软件开发篇:具备软件开发的思维与逻辑能力
制作APK软件需要具备软件开发的思维和逻辑能力,例如:善于分析问题,具备解决问题的能力,学会抽象思考等。还需要掌握一些软件开发工具和方法,如:版本控制工具、测试工具、调试技术等等。
5. 精通篇:深入学习APK软件制作技巧
在学习和掌握Android基础知识、Java语言基础知识、APK文件结构等技能的基础上,需要进一步深入学习APK软件制作技巧。例如:防止应用被反编译、如何修改APK文件资源、增加APK文件版本信息等等。
综上所述,学习林西APK软件制作需要掌握多种知识和技能,需要充分发挥自己的思维和逻辑能力,同时也需要耐心和勤奋。只有不断学习和实践,才能不断提高自己的APK软件制作技艺,成为一名优秀的APK软件开发者。
制作apk软件是现代程序开发中的重要技能之一。而学习林西apk软件制作的完整教程,可以帮助初学者深入了解apk软件制作的要素和流程,掌握从入门到精通的技能。
本文将介绍学习林西apk软件制作的完整教程,分为5个大段落进行讲解。第一部分将介绍apk软件的基础知识;第二部分将讲解制作android应用程序的前置条件;第三部分将教授如何创建一个新的android应用;第四部分将介绍android应用程序的UI设计;第五部分将讲解如何打包并发布android应用程序。
1. apk软件的基础知识
apk软件是android应用程序的一种格式,类似于PC端的exe文件。在android系统下,apk文件是一种安装包,用于安装和运行android应用程序。
apk文件包含了android应用程序的所有资源和代码,其中资源包括图像、声音、文本等,代码包括java代码和android系统的API。
android应用程序是基于java语言开发的,开发者需要使用android开发工具包(Android Studio)来编写代码和创建应用程序。
2. 制作android应用程序的前置条件
在制作android应用程序之前,开发者需要具备一定的编程基础,理解面向对象编程(OOP)的核心概念和Java语言的语法。
同时,开发者需要安装jdk(Java Development Kit)和Android Studio开发工具包。仅仅安装这些软件是不够的,还需要配置环境变量以及测试环境是否配置正确。
3. 如何创建一个新的android应用
创建一个新的android应用程序需要用到Android Studio开发工具包。
步骤如下:
(1)新建项目。
在Android Studio中选择“File”->“New”->“New Project”,填写项目信息(如项目名称、包名、项目位置等)并选择项目的API,即可创建一个新的android应用程序。
(2)添加用户界面元素。
在新建的android应用程序中,在res/layout目录下创建一个新的xml文件,添加用户界面元素,如TextView、EditText、Button等。
(3)编写java代码。
在MainActivity.java文件中,编写该android应用程序的逻辑代码。
(4)运行该android应用程序。
在AVD Manager中创建或选择一个虚拟设备,并运行该android应用程序。
4. android应用程序的UI设计
UI设计是整个android应用程序开发过程中最为重要的部分。开发者需要学会如何设计android应用程序的用户界面,如何实现用户界面元素的交互效果等。
在UI设计中,开发者需要了解一些基本的概念和技能,如常见的用户界面元素、布局、样式和主题等。
5. 如何打包并发布android应用程序
在打包android应用程序之前,需要做好一些准备工作。
(1)生成签名证书。
在Android Studio中选择“Build”->“Generate Signed APK”,填写签名证书的信息(如证书名称、密码、有效期等)即可生成签名证书。
(2)生成发布APK包。
在Android Studio中选择“Build”->“Build APK”,即可生成发布APK包。
(3)上传发布APK包至Play商店。
打包完毕后,通过Play开发者账号登录Google Play Console,上传发布APK包至Play商店。可能需要等待审核才能正式上架。
通过本文的学习,读者可以了解学习林西apk软件制作的完整教程,掌握从入门到精通的技能。同时,制作android应用程序也需要不断地练习和实践,才能够真正掌握这一技能。希望本文能够帮助读者顺利的走上android应用程序开发之路。
扫码添加客服微信获取开发报价

相关推荐
- 聊城麻将开发公司-深度解析:运河App程序的高阶技巧
- 绍兴麻将开发公司_掌握东丽H5小程序开发的资深教程,从入门到精通!
- 广州麻将开发公司_从零开始,如何制作一个功能全面的原平小程序平台?
- 辽源麻将开发公司_学习如皋H5小程序开发:从入门到实战教程
- 珠海麻将开发公司-定制你的宁国小程序,打造独特品牌形象
- 泰安麻将开发公司_详解元氏ios软件平台的开发教程,快速上手iOS开发!
- 香港麻将开发公司_深入剖析宏伟的H5小程序实现技巧
- 银川麻将开发公司-探寻孙吴手机软件资深研发的技术与创新
- 昌都麻将开发公司_深入剖析丰润ios软件,资深讲解带你玩转!
- 那曲麻将开发公司-定制化德ios软件,专业服务尽在掌握
- 淮北麻将开发公司_西塞山手机软件开发:优化智能生活,轻松畅享数字社交
- 佛山麻将开发公司-如何学习同江手机app外包:实用教程分享
- 鹤壁麻将开发公司_庆安市手机软件平台开发:打造便利高效的移动应用程序
- 乌鲁木齐麻将开发公司_掌握新邱apk软件的高级应用技巧,成为专业用户!
- 延边麻将开发公司_工农安卓软件资深制作专家分享制作经验
- 贵州麻将开发公司-全面详解沭阳app软件外包流程及注意事项
- 呼和浩特麻将开发公司_辽阳手机软件专业研发领航者
- 湘潭麻将开发公司-成为永年小程序专业开发的行家!
- 绥化麻将开发公司_打造您的专属平泉旅游H5小程序——平泉H5小程序定制服务
- 宜春麻将开发公司-打造优秀的中阳app程序,平台制作绝不马虎!
- 自贡麻将开发公司-深度解析双城小程序资深开发的技术要点
- 泸州麻将开发公司_定制优质繁昌H5小程序,助力企业发展!
- 玉溪麻将开发公司_打造优质手机软件平台——宣州开发方案简析
- 通化麻将开发公司_深度解析武进app程序的资深搭建技巧
- 淄博麻将开发公司-打造稳固基石,磐石APP程序平台搭建教程
- 咸宁麻将开发公司-深入学习黄石港软件的高级教程
- 白山麻将开发公司_掌握宝清app程序制作技巧,打造高级用户体验
- 平凉麻将开发公司-铁力手机软件资深定制指南:打造独具特色的定制化应用!
- 绥化麻将开发公司_南关小程序平台制作,为您打造高效便捷的移动应用程序!
- 舟山麻将开发公司-定制你的安卓软件,选择雨山高级定制!